Managers Are Expected to Lead AI
Adoption - Even When No One Feels Ready
AI is no longer a future conversation; it is already influencing decisions, reshaping workflows, and changing what constitutes “good performance.” Yet inside most organisations, the reality is uneven: some people experiment, others avoid it, many feel unsure. Managers are often squeezed between pressure to deliver value and teams worried about trust, workload, and even job security.
The tools will keep changing. What won’t change are the management and leadership tasks: creating clarity, building capability, and putting responsible guardrails in place .
At MCE, we don’t treat AI as a technology rollout or a set of tips and tricks. We treat it as a management and leadership capability, and governance challenge that must translate into practical choices and Monday-morning action.
The shift now is from scattered experimentation to confident, responsible use: knowing where AI genuinely improves efficiency and outcomes, where it doesn’t, and how teams need to work and think differently to sustain results.
With the EU AI Act raising expectations in Europe and similar scrutiny building across MEA, the question is no longer whether you will engage with AI.
The question is whether you’ll guide it intentionally, using critical thinking, boundaries, and trust – or let it take control first.
